feat:完善项目

This commit is contained in:
henry
2022-01-17 09:57:57 +08:00
parent 6d075dab4f
commit b50fdb0d44
30 changed files with 70 additions and 84 deletions

View File

@ -35,7 +35,7 @@ type (
func (c *Instance) Login() InstanceLoginCallback {
return func(params *InstanceLoginParams) *InstanceLoginReturn {
token := utils.JWTEncrypt(config.SettingInfo.TokenEffectTime, map[string]interface{}{
token := utils.JWTEncrypt(utils.StringToInt(config.SystemConfig[config.SysTokenEffectTime]), map[string]interface{}{
config.TokenForUID: fmt.Sprintf("%d", params.UID),
})
_session := session.NewEnterprise()
@ -53,7 +53,7 @@ func (c *Instance) Login() InstanceLoginCallback {
service.Publish(config.EventForRedisHashProduce, config.RedisKeyForAccountEnterprise, _session.UIDToString(), _session)
return &InstanceLoginReturn{Token: token, TokenEffectTime: config.SettingInfo.TokenEffectTime}
return &InstanceLoginReturn{Token: token, TokenEffectTime: utils.StringToInt(config.SystemConfig[config.SysTokenEffectTime])}
}
}